  7. Some surprising (for me, at least) info about the Phantom, in "Where Have All the Phantoms Gone?" from Air & Space magazine. ( http://www.airspacemag.com/military-aviation/Where-Have-All-the-Phantoms-Gone.html ) ... Control sensitivity varies widely. It takes full aft stick to raise the nose for takeoff, yet at certain fuel loadings and at speeds just above Mach 0.9 at low altitude, moving the stick only one inch can produce 6 Gs on the airframe. At above Mach 2, on the other hand, the shock wave that is created moves the center of lift so far aft that pulling the stick all the way back produces only about 2 Gs. (Any flight sim doing this? :joystick:) ... The commander of the 82nd Aerial Target and Recovery Squadron, which conducts the drone shootdowns, is Lieutenant Colonel J.D. “Bare” Lee.
